06/10/2006

October 28th | 4pm-9pm
Electric Cafe in the Interval Bar | Sheffield University
With a history of live and studio engineering for the likes of Fila Brazilia, Arctic Monkeys and Gomez, the Little Gem's influences are diverse to say the least. After the disappointment of having to cancel his Australian support slot with the Arctic Monkeys due to a broken arm, this will the first LG gig of the year. Expect a range of textured laptop soundscapes, guitar explorations, and vocal melodies.

Little gem - Australia cancellation
LG was due to support the Arctic Monkeys in Australia this month, showcasing tracks off his next release, due later in the year. Unfortunately, John Ashton (aka Little Gem) broke his elbow, and is out of action for a few weeks.
